+<refnamediv>
+ <refname>vfs_media_harmony</refname>
+ <refpurpose>Allow multiple Avid clients to share a network drive.</refpurpose>
+</refnamediv>
+
+<refsynopsisdiv>
+ <cmdsynopsis>
+ <command>vfs objects = media_harmony</command>
+ </cmdsynopsis>
+</refsynopsisdiv>
+
+<refsect1>
+ <title>DESCRIPTION</title>
+
+ <para>This VFS module is part of the
+ <citerefentry><refentrytitle>samba</refentrytitle>
+ <manvolnum>7</manvolnum></citerefentry> suite.</para>
+
+ <para>The <command>vfs_media_harmony</command> VFS module allows
+ Avid editorial workstations to share a network drive. It does
+ this by:</para>
+ <orderedlist continuation="restarts" inheritnum="ignore" numeration="arabic">
+ <listitem><para>Giving each client their own copy of the Avid
+ msmMMOB.mdb and msmFMID.pmr files and Creating directories.</para></listitem>
+ <listitem><para>Allowing each client to explicitly control the
+ write time the Avid application sees on Avid media directories.</para></listitem>
+ </orderedlist>
+
+ <para>This module is stackable.</para>
+
+</refsect1>

+<refsect1>
+ <title>CONFIGURATION</title>
+
+ <para><command>vfs_media_harmony</command> automatically redirects
+ requests from clients for Avid database files or an Avid Creating
+ directory to a client-specific version of the file. No
+ configuration beyond enabling the module is needed to get this
+ portion of its functionality working.</para>
+
+ <para>If Mac and Windows Avid clients will be accessing the same
+ folder, they should be given separate share definitions, with
+ hidden Mac files vetoed on the Windows share. See EXAMPLES.</para>
+
+ <para>To allow each client to control when the Avid application
+ refreshes their Avid databases, create files for each client
+ and each Avid media directory with the name
+ [avid_dir_name]_[client_ip_address]_[client_username].
+ To trigger Avid database refreshes, update the write time on
+ those files. See EXAMPLES.</para>
+
+ <para>It is also necessary for the <command>cache locked write times = no</command>
+ option to be set for clients to be able to control their Avid
+ media folder write times.</para>
+
+</refsect1>

+<refsect1>
+ <title>EXAMPLES</title>
+
+ <para>Enable media_harmony for Mac and Windows clients:</para>
+<programlisting>
+ <smbconfsection name="[avid_mac]"/>
+ <smbconfoption name="path">/avid</smbconfoption>
+ <smbconfoption name="vfs objects">media_harmony</smbconfoption>
+ <smbconfoption name="cache locked write times">no</smbconfoption>
+ <smbconfsection name="[avid_win]"/>
+ <smbconfoption name="path">/avid</smbconfoption>
+ <smbconfoption name="vfs objects">media_harmony</smbconfoption>
+ <smbconfoption name="cache locked write times">no</smbconfoption>
+ <smbconfoption name="veto files">/.DS_Store/._@/.Trash@/.Spotlight@/.hidden/.hotfiles@/.vol/</smbconfoption>
+ <smbconfoption name="delete veto files">yes</smbconfoption>
+</programlisting>
+
+ <para>Create the files that will allow users david and susan
+ to control their own Avid database refreshes:</para>
+<programlisting>
+ touch '/avid/OMFI MediaFiles_192.168.1.10_david' \
+ '/avid/OMFI MediaFiles_192.168.1.11_susan' \
+ '/avid/Avid MediaFiles/MXF/1_192.168.1.10_david' \
+ '/avid/Avid MediaFiles/MXF/1_192.168.1.11_susan'
+</programlisting>
+ <para>Trigger an Avid database refresh for user david:</para>
+<programlisting>
+ touch '/avid/OMFI MediaFiles_192.168.1.10_david' \
+ '/avid/Avid MediaFiles/MXF/1_192.168.1.10_david'
+</programlisting>
+
+ <para>If you have a large number of Avid media folders to manage,
+ you can give each editor a suitably modified version of
+ examples/scripts/vfs/media_harmony/trigger_avid_update.py to
+ create and update these files.</para>
+
+</refsect1>

+<refsect1>
+ <title>CAVEATS</title>
+
+ <para><command>vfs_media_harmony</command> is designed to work with
+ Avid editing applications that look in the Avid MediaFiles or
+ OMFI MediaFiles directories for media. It is not designed to work
+ as expected in all circumstances for general use. For example: It
+ is possible to open a client-specific file such as
+ msmMMOB.mdb_192.168.1.10_userx even though it doesn't show up
+ in a directory listing.</para>
+
+</refsect1>
